I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S 23. While cooking, the internal temperature of the appliance reaches several hundred degrees. To avoid personal injury, never place unprotected hands inside the appliance until it has cooled to room temperature. 24. When cooking, do not place the appliance against a wall or against other appliances.

Care, Cleaning & Storage Clean your air fryer oven and accessories after each use. Always unplug the air fryer oven and let it cool to room temperature before cleaning. Never use harsh chemical detergents, scouring pads, or powders on any of the parts or components.
